Output 66a808265bc663924bee7b29ca74440590c2db48b76ddb9ad4245697ceb683c0:1

value
14588606
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d87122a2e892f1b87b72cf04f19bb89275ac18ea OP_EQUAL
address
3MRTQktLpVGhBiHWhJbUWUDi7JjNPqrp7s
transaction
66a808265bc663924bee7b29ca74440590c2db48b76ddb9ad4245697ceb683c0
spent
true